Understanding Registered Agent Services

Services provided by registered agents fulfill a vital role in business compliance and representing businesses legally. A registered agent functions as the designated point of contact for a company, receiving crucial documents such as notices of legal matters, tax forms, and formal communications from the state. This function is essential for Limited Liability Companies and corporations, as they are mandated by law to retain a registered agent in the jurisdiction of incorporation or where they do business.

Registered Agent Costs and Expenses

Grasping the costs associated with hiring a registered agent is crucial for any business owner dealing with the challenges of regulatory compliance. Registered agent offerings can differ significantly in cost, usually ranging from as little as fifty dollars to various hundred dollars annually, depending on the service provider and the offerings available. Factors that affect costs include the area of the agent, the types of services available, and any supplemental features such as mail handling or regulatory reminders.

Budget-friendly licensed representative options tend to offer essential offerings, while extensive packages, which may include yearly regulatory submissions and personalized client assistance, command higher fees. It's crucial to assess your specific business necessities and think about what offerings are essential. A few registered agent providers may also charge additional for certain tasks, such as dealing with law-related documents or facilitating corporate correspondence redirecting.

Criteria for Registered Agents

To function as a registered agent, there are particular legal requirements that must be met, which can differ by state. Generally, a registered agent must be a resident of the jurisdiction in which the company is registered or a legally authorized entity to conduct business in that state. This indicates that both individuals and entities can act as registered agents, provided they meet local regulations regarding residency and authorization.

Another essential requirement is the availability of the registered agent during regular hours. This guarantees that they can receive and handle significant legal documents, such as service of process, on behalf of the entity. The registered agent is required to provide a physical address, often referred to as the official office, where official correspondence can be received. P.O. Boxes are typically not allowed for this function.

In addition to the above requirements, registered agents must ensure adherence with continuing obligations. This includes being responsible for sending legal documents to the entity in a efficient manner and maintaining current records with the state. Failure to meet these requirements can lead to fines for the company, including possible loss of good standing, making it vital to choose a trustworthy registered agent service.
